A Whitehall Township man punched his girlfriend's cat Saturday (June 4) and killed it, according to a humane society official.
Kevin M. Elskoe, 25, of 3315 Carbon St. told authorities that he hit the cat to ''discipline'' it for going after his friend, said Orlando Aguirre of the Lehigh County Humane Society.
The girlfriend, 31-year-old Tanica Session of the same address, found the 5-year-old, black and white cat dead under a computer desk around 8:40 p.m., Aguirre said.
Elskoe took the cat outside and buried it, Aguirre said.
Animal cruelty charges against Elskoe were filed on June 7 with District Judge Joan Snyder of Whitehall Township, Aguirre said, and a summons is to be issued.
